In this engaging drama, Toni Collette stars as Ellie Klug, a music journalist tasked with tracking down her reclusive ex-boyfriend, a legendary musician who vanished a decade ago. As Ellie embarks on this journey, she is accompanied by a quirky amateur documentary filmmaker, played by Thomas Haden Church, adding a layer of humor and complexity to her quest. Directed by Megan Griffiths, the film explores themes of love, loss, and self-discovery, set against the backdrop of Seattle’s vibrant music scene.
